THE END OF TOGETHERNESS is a surreal parable about a man forced to end the true self he is. This short film, shot in a day in a German forest, is Nils’ 1st short film which granted him acceptance into AFI’s Directing program. The dreamlike and surreal tone, a visual language inspired by German painter Caspar David Friedrichs and it’s story about personal duality are recurring themes and aesthetics throughout Nils’ work since this first narrative film.
